21 Bible Verses about Chosen Disciples
Most Relevant Verses
And when it was day, He called His disciples to Him: and having chosen twelve from them, whom He also named apostles;
You did not choose me, but I chose you, and placed you in your position, that you may go forth and bear fruit, and your fruit may abide: in order that He may give you whatsoever you may ask in my name.
If you were of the world, the world would love its own: but because you are not of the world, but I have chosen you out of the world, on this account the world hates you.
I do not speak concerning you all: I know whom I have chosen: but that the Scripture may be fulfilled, He that eateth bread with me has lifted up his heel against me.
And praying they said, Thou, O Lord, Heart-searcher of all, show up the one of these two, whom thou hast chosen
from the day on which, having given commandment through the Holy Ghost to the apostles whom He had chosen, He was received up.
Salute Rufus the elect in the Lord, and his mother and mine.
And the Lord said to him, Go: because he is a vessel of election to me, to bear my name both before the Gentiles, and kings, and sons of Israel:
as he elected us in himself before the foundation of the world, that we should be holy and blameless in his presence.
But we ought to give thanks to God always for you, brethren beloved of the Lord, because God chose you from the beginning unto salvation through sanctification of the Spirit and belief of the truth;
Hear, my beloved brethren. Has not God chosen the poor in the world rich in faith, and heirs of the kingdom which he has promised to those who love him with divine love?
Therefore, brethren, be the more diligent to make your calling and election sure: for doing these things you can never fall.
These will make war with the Lamb, and the Lamb shall conquer them, because he is the Lord of lords, and King of kings: and with him are the called, and the elect, and the faithful.
for the children not having been born, neither having done anything good or evil, in order that the purpose of God might stand according to election not of works, but of him that calleth,
And there being much disputation, Peter, having arisen, said to them, Men, brethren, you know that from ancient days God chose among you, that the Gentiles should hear the word of the gospel through my mouth, and believe.
but God has chosen the foolish things of the world, that he may confound the wise; and God has chosen the weak things of the world, that he may confound the strong;
Peter, an apostle of Jesus Christ, to the elect sojourners of the Dispersion of Pontus, Galatia, Cappadocia, Asia, and Bithynia, according to the foreknowledge of God the Father, through sanctification of the Spirit, unto obedience and sprinkling of the blood of Jesus Christ. Grace to you, and peace, be multiplied.
and God has chosen the base-born of the world, and those of no reputation, the things which are not, that He may set at nought the things which are,
